Little Piney Creek is a cold-water trout stream near Rolla

little piney creeklane springtroutmark twain national forestsprings

Little Piney Creek is one of the water features that gives Phelps County outdoor identity close to Rolla. The Forest Service says Little Piney Creek is considered a Wild Trout Management Area by MDC, and that Lane, Piney, and Yancy Mill springs provide the cold water needed for rainbow trout.

The same page says the creek is accessible from Lane Spring Recreation Area and Milldam Hollow off Forest Road 1735. That matters because the public access is tied to named federal recreation locations, not to every creek bank.

For anglers, hikers, and visitors, use the Forest Service page for access context and then check MDC for current fishing rules. Little Piney is a specific spring-fed stream system, not a generic creek stop.
